WEBJun 16, 2015 · Do not remove any membranes on the back of the ribs. Season with 2 Parts Coarse Grind Pepper and 1 Part Coarse Sea Salt. …

1. Heat your smoker to 275 F
2. Trim any excess fat off your ribs. Do not remove any membranes on the back of the ribs.
3. Mix the rub and shake it on the ribs on both sides evenly until you have a nice texture forming. See pictures.
4. Smoke for 3 hours - spritzing with a mixture of 25% Apple Cider Vinegar and 75% Water every 45 minutes
